Prompt Engineer: Beyond the Buzzword

AI/ML
ingeniere di prompt
facebooktwitterlinkedinreddit

In the bustling world of tech, the emergence of “prompt engineer” as a professional title has sparked a mix of curiosity and skepticism. Is this role just another fleeting tech trend, or does it herald a significant shift in the tech job market? As artificial intelligence (AI) continues to evolve, the role of a prompt engineer is proving not just relevant, but essential, navigating the intersection between human ingenuity and machine learning (ML) capabilities.

Moreover, with the AI boom, prompt engineering is rapidly claiming the spotlight as possibly the hottest job in the tech industry, with salaries of up to 300,000 overtaking traditional giants like data scientists. But will this boom last?

Let’s delve into what this role entails, the skills it demands, and its increasing importance in the AI-driven ecosystem

According to Emanuele Fabbiani, Head of AI at Xtream, prompt engineering and the specific tools for the role can only grow in the immediate future: “All companies will have a big interest in adopting these tools, only that the big tech companies will provide the infrastructure while it will be up to the individual startups to create niche applications that meet the real needs of the market,” he explains.

The Essence of Prompt Engineering

Skills and Knowledge Requirements
Prompt engineering transcends traditional programming; it is an artful science requiring a nuanced blend of skills:

  • Technical Expertise: A solid grasp of AI model architectures and ML principles is foundational. Prompt engineers must understand how models interpret inputs and generate outputs.
  • Linguistic and Psychological Insight: This role demands a keen understanding of language and human psychology to craft prompts that effectively steer AI responses.
  • Problem-Solving Prowess: Each prompt is a mini-challenge, requiring the ability to deconstruct and simplify complex issues into clear, actionable inputs.

Essential Tools for the Trade
Prompt engineers arm themselves with a variety of tools to sculpt and refine their prompts:

  • Development Platforms: Platforms like OpenAI’s Playground are crucial for real-time testing and refinement of prompts.
  • Analytics Software: Tools that analyze how models react to different prompts are indispensable for fine-tuning.
  • Version Control Systems: These systems are vital for managing prompt iterations, particularly in collaborative environments.

Industry Adoption and Career Prospects

Growing Demand in Major Companies
From tech behemoths like Google to dynamic AI startups, the demand for prompt engineers is surging as companies recognize the value of mastering AI interactions. This role is pivotal in various applications:

  • Customer Service Automation: Designing prompts that direct AI to manage customer queries with precision.
  • Content Creation: Leveraging AI for producing diverse content, from creative writing to code.
  • Educational Enhancements: Creating personalized educational tools through adaptive prompts.

The Rising Star of Tech Careers

Replacing Data Scientists as the Go-To Tech Job?
With the explosion of AI technology, prompt engineering is not just an emerging field—it’s a critical one. The role uniquely combines technical acumen with creative and strategic thinking. As AI becomes more ubiquitous, the ability to effectively communicate with and guide AI systems is becoming more crucial. In this light, prompt engineers may soon be as commonplace and sought-after in tech companies as data scientists once were, heralding a new era in career opportunities within the tech industry.

Conclusion
Far from being merely a buzzword, prompt engineering represents a burgeoning domain that marries human creativity with AI capabilities. As industries increasingly rely on AI, the role of the prompt engineer is set to grow not only in importance but also in necessity, securing its place as a fundamental and exciting career path in the future of technology.
